  • Proxmox is fantastic. I just setup a server in about 3 minutes! The really nice aspect of using OpenVZ is that it extremely maximises your hardware. As a test, setup a KVM of a server and then setup the exact same server using an OpenVZ container and notice the RAM utilization. You could literally run dozens, upon dozens of VMs using OpenVZ!

    Proxmox makes using this type of virtualization so easy a child could do it. Doesn't work with windoze servers though.
